Specifications
- Engines: 2× Honeywell TFE731-5BR-1H (4750 lbf each)
- Range: 2525 nm
- Cruise: 419 kts
- Seats: 8
- Ceiling: 41000 ft
Operations & Cabin
Forward 4-place club / aft single seat opposite 3-place divan; belted lavatory and crew jumpseat; forward galley; private aft lavatory Monitor in forward bulkhead, Airshow system, Collins CMS, dual DVD players; re-striped 2020 Avionics: Collins Pro Line 21 (modernization w/ SVS, WAAS/LPV, TAWS, ADS‑B Out)

This airframe, registered as N438WR, is a 2009-built Hawker 850XP with serial number 258983. The airframe is owned by R2G2 LLC, a corporation based in Wilmington, DE, US, and is registered in the US. The airframe carries a market valuation of $2,750,000 and has undergone avionics modernization and equipment updates consistent with late-model Hawker 850XP refurbishments. Ownership is recorded to R2G2 LLC in Wilmington, Delaware, and the aircraft’s configuration and registry reflect corporate operation rather than individual private use.
The cabin of this Hawker 850XP is equipped in a forward 4-place club arrangement with an aft single seat opposite a 3-place divan, providing seating for 8 with a belted lavatory and crew jumpseat; the fit also includes a forward galley and a private aft lavatory. Avionics modernization fitted for this airframe is the Collins Pro Line 21 suite, upgraded with Synthetic Vision System (SVS), WAAS/LPV capability, Terrain Awareness and Warning System (TAWS), and ADS‑B Out compliant equipment, supporting contemporary airspace requirements. Typical mission profiles for this configuration include medium-range corporate transport and on-demand charter missions within the U.S. and transcontinental sectors up to its stated 2,525 nm range, operating from corporate bases such as the owner’s Wilmington, DE area. Maintenance considerations for this specific aircraft align with operator-level heavy inspections and engine increments tied to the Honeywell TFE731-5BR-1H powerplants and avionics lifecycle management associated with Pro Line 21 modernizations.
The Hawker 850XP occupies the mid-size, transcontinental business jet niche within Hawker Beechcraft’s lineup, offering a blend of speed and cabin flexibility exemplified by this 2009 airframe. Competing models in its class include later-generation midsize jets and light-heavy hybrids that emphasize cabin comfort and range comparable to this model’s 419 kts cruise and 41,000 ft ceiling. Buyer and charter demand for refurbished 850XPs often focuses on updated avionics and interior layouts like those on N438WR, with resale considerations driven by engine hours, avionics currency (notably ADS‑B/WAAS/LPV and TAWS), and overall value placed at $2,750,000 for this unit.
